Marie MARCHAND
Parents & Family of Marie MARCHAND
Born: abt. 1787 in Québec Province, Canada
Parents of Marie MARCHAND
Grandparents of Marie MARCHAND
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Marie married Joseph MORISSET 26 April 1803 in Bécancour, Nicolet,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Joseph MORISSET was born 9 November 1777 in Bécancour, Nicolet, Province of Québec, Canada . Joseph died 14 October 1835 in Bécancour, Nicolet, Lower Canada . Joseph was the child of Joseph MORISSET and Marie-Marguerite MERCIER.
Marie MARCHAND died 25 September 1854 in Princeville, Canada.

Québec Place Names Through History
Québec has been described by several names during different periods of its history. Knowing the period name can make older records easier to recognize.
- Early 1600s–1760
- Canada, New France
- 1760–1763
- Canada
- 1763–1791
- Province of Québec
- 1791–1867
- Lower Canada
- 1867–present
- Québec, Canada
